McDonald's Corporation v Steel & Morris EWHC QB 366, known as " the McLibel case " was an English lawsuit filed by McDonald's Corporation against environmental activists Helen Steel and David Morris ( often referred to as " The McLibel Two ") over a pamphlet critical of the company.
Following the decision, the European Court of Human Rights ( ECHR ) ruled in Steel & Morris v United Kingdom that the pair had been denied a fair trial, in breach of Article 6 of the European Convention on Human Rights and that their conduct should have been protected by Article 10 of the Convention.
In 1990, McDonald's brought libel proceedings against five London Greenpeace supporters, Paul Gravett, Andrew Clarke and Jonathan O ' Farrell, as well as Steel and Morris, for distributing the pamphlet on the streets of London.
Steel and Morris, however, chose to defend the case.
Steel and Morris called 180 witnesses, seeking to prove their assertions about food poisoning, unpaid overtime, misleading claims about how much McDonald's recycled, and " corporate spies sent to infiltrate the ranks of London Greenpeace ".
McDonald's spent several million pounds, while Steel and Morris spent £ 30, 000 ; this disparity in funds meant Steel and Morris were not able to call all the witnesses they wanted, especially witnesses from South America who were intended to support their claims about McDonalds ' activities in that continent's rain forests.
